Quality Control Inspector - Denver, CO
Position/Job Summary:
The 2nd Shift Quality Control Inspector is responsible for performing in-process and final inspections of sheet metal components to ensure compliance with drawings, specifications, and customer requirements. This position plays a key role in maintaining product quality, preventing defects, and supporting a culture of operational excellence.
Key Responsibilities
- Perform in-process, first-article, and final inspections using standard metrology tools (calipers, height gauges, micrometers, pin gauges, thread gauges, etc.)
- Verify part conformance to engineering drawings, tolerances, and work instructions
- Read and interpret blueprints, GD&T, and manufacturing specifications
- Document inspection results accurately in quality records, travelers, and digital systems
- Identify nonconformances
- Conduct surface finish, weld quality and dimensional inspections as required
- Collaborate with production operators and supervisors to resolve quality issues
-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ment
- Support continuous improvement initiatives
